By Ashley Broughton Simpson should serve a six-year prison sentence — the lowest end of the minimum sentencing range — defense attorney Gabe Grasso said in a sentencing memorandum filed Tuesday. Simpson faces a maximum sentence of up to life. A presentencing report recommends that he be sentenced to 18 years. A jury on October 3 convicted Simpson, 61, and co-defendant Clarence “C.J.” Stewart on 12 charges, including conspiracy to commit a crime, robbery, assault and kidnapping with a deadly weapon. Their conviction stems from a September 13, 2007, incident at Las Vegas’ Palace Station hotel and casino. Prosecutors alleged that Simpson led a group of men who used threats, guns and force to take sports memorabilia from dealers Bruce Fromong and Al Beardsley |
